The Schedule of Assets is a crucial document that organises key asset information for easy access by family members, ensuring a smooth estate management process. It includes details on financial assets, digital assets, properties, insurance, CPF, businesses, and valuables. Regular updates are essential to avoid delays and ensure accuracy.
Writing a Schedule of Assets before their death will make it easier for the executor to identify what assets the testator owns, and ascertain how much they are worth, and help distribute the assets faster after the testator has passed away.

2. Can I edit the SOA after the Final Will has been generated?
Once the Final Will is generated, the SOA is automatically produced in PDF format and cannot be edited within the system.
However, clients may manually update the downloaded PDF to add or amend asset information and keep the updated version.
This does not affect the legality or instructions in the Will. The SOA serves as a reference document listing the client’s assets.
3. Does updating the SOA change the instructions in the Will?
No. The SOA is purely documentation. Any manual edits do not change the distributions or instructions stated in the Will.
